C#使用ADO.NET创建SQL Server数据库
来源:互联网 发布:小米网络助手校正失败 编辑:程序博客网 时间:2024/05/16 14:51
参考如何使用 ADO.NET 和 Visual C# .NET 以编程方式创建 SQL Server 数据库写了一个控制台程序用来创建SQL Server数据库。
原理很简单,首先利用SqlConnection连接master数据库,然后利用SqlCommand执行创建数据库的T-SQL语句。
注意:对于SQL Server 2008 R2,mdf文件的Size应至少大于3MB。
class Program { static void Main(string[] args) { string exit = string.Empty; SqlConnection conn = new SqlConnection("Server=localhost;Integrated Security=SSPI;database=master"); conn.Open(); while (exit != "n") { Console.WriteLine("Please input your database name: \n"); string dbname = Console.ReadLine().Trim(); string str = string.Format("CREATE DATABASE {0} ON PRIMARY" + "(NAME = {0}_Data, FILENAME = 'C:\\{0}Data.mdf', " + "SIZE = 3MB, MAXSIZE = 10MB, FILEGROWTH = 10%) " + "LOG ON (NAME = {0}_Log, FILENAME='C:\\{0}Log.ldf', " + "SIZE = 1MB, MAXSIZE = 5MB, FILEGROWTH = 10%)", dbname); using (SqlCommand cmd = new SqlCommand(str, conn)) { cmd.ExecuteNonQuery(); } Console.WriteLine("Do you want to continue\n? [y/n]"); exit = Console.ReadLine(); exit = exit.Trim().ToLower(); } conn.Close(); } }
0 0
- C#使用ADO.NET创建SQL Server数据库
- C#操作sql server数据库 ADO.NET
- 如何使用 ADO.NET 和 Visual C++ .NET 以编程方式创建 SQL Server 数据库
- 如何使用C#和ADO.NET在SQL Server数据库读取和写入blob数据
- c#操作sql server数据库(ADO.net基础)
- C# ADO.NET之SQL Server数据库操作
- 使用ADO.NET自定义类MyDBase连接SQL Server数据库
- 使用ADO.NET对SQL Server数据库进行访问
- 利用ADO.NET连接SQl SERVER 数据库
- ADO.NET连接SQL Server数据库示例
- ADO.NET连接SQL Server数据库
- ADO.NET连接SQL Server数据库
- ADO.NET访问SQL Server数据库
- ADO.NET连接SQL Server数据库
- Ado.net与SQL Server数据库编程
- Visual C# .NET 以编程方式创建 SQL Server 数据库
- 使用ADO.NET配置SQL Server事务处理
- VC++使用ADO连接SQL Server数据库
- oracle sql 学习记录
- 第十四周项目3-立体类族共有的抽象类
- Java开发牛人十大必备网站
- rz/sz的安装与使用
- centos6起/etc/syslog.conf不再有!而是/etc/rsyslog.conf代替
- C#使用ADO.NET创建SQL Server数据库
- Eclipse Kepler更改注释字体大小
- apkplug插件托管服务简化与简介-05
- C程序设计语言(K&R)学习笔记--8.结构体
- loop through two arrays and group them based on a condition
- C++中 I/O流总结
- 相似设计模式的区别
- java秒数转换成标准的北京时间
- Silverlight如何与JS相互调用